Photographer Mike Butt explores the underground community and sport of pigeon racing.

Home Straight is a photo series which explores the underground community and sport of pigeon racing. The story is based around is Nicola Gay and racing partner Bill Silk. Nicola is a single mum and was looking for a way to meet new people in the area, and a hobby to keep her active and social.

Pigeon fancying is an extremely inclusive sport, and within a few weeks of joining her local club, Worle East, Nicola had found companionship and friendship with many of the members. Some members even donated their birds to Nicola so that she could kick-start her hobby. The sport has given Nicola a purpose and introduced her to many new faces in the area.

All the individuals featured within the project are members of the Worle East Club
